Lithia Motors, Inc. (NYSE:LAD - Get Free Report) has been assigned a consensus recommendation of "Moderate Buy" from the eleven research firms that are presently covering the company, Marketbeat reports. Three analysts have rated the stock with a hold recommendation and eight have given a buy recommendation to the company. The average twelve-month price target among brokerages that have covered the stock in the last year is $380.9091.

Lithia Motors (NYSE:LAD -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, July 29th. The company reported $10.24 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$9.78 by $0.46. The business had revenue of $9.58 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$9.56 billion. Lithia Motors had a net margin of 2.39% and a return on equity of 13.21%. Research analysts forecast that Lithia Motors will post 34.45 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Lithia Motors announced that its Board of Directors has authorized a stock buyback program on Tuesday, August 26th that authorizes the company to buyback $750.00 million in shares. This buyback authorization authorizes the company to repurchase up to 9%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back programs are typically an indication that the company's board of directors believes its shares are undervalued.

Lithia Motors Company Profile

Lithia Motors, Inc operates as an automotive retailer worldwide. It operates in two segments, Vehicle Operations and Financing Operations. The company's Vehicle Operations segment sells new and used vehicles; provides parts, repair, and maintenance services; vehicle finance; and insurance products. Its Financing Operations segment provides financing to customers buying and leasing retail vehicles.
